On Wed, 10 Nov 2004 23:35:51 -0500, Robert Deaton <false.hopes at gmail.com> wrote:
> Quick idea though. Why exactly include all these functions that are
> exactly the same except for a few characters and add bloat to the
> software. Why not have a developer plugin or addon, in which they can
> download this seperately to reduce the bloat of the main wordpress
> implementation, and any plugins that depend on certain functions can
> embed them from within the developer package.

The changes are not intended for making WP friendlier to developers as
much as they are designed to make it friendlier for end-users who may
have a one-off hack gene :)
It is good, in my opinion to see WordPress giving users the options to
either return or echo, and since wordpress has to do it, I think a
plugin or pack wouldn't quite cut it. This same thread will then get
repeated every once in six months or so, with someone asking why
something that seems common-sensical is not there in the core.
